Airsoft is a shooting sport where participants use airsoft weapons to fire 6mm plastic BBs. Airsoft groups can differ in size from a few participants to many squads, fire teams, and separate forces based on the scale of the field and player turnout.
Primary airsoft weapons include the AK47 Kalashnikov, Heckler and Koch H&K G36, Colt M4 Carbine design assault rifles which are reproduced using automatic electric (AEG) airsoft guns. Sidearms usually consist of Beretta M9, 1911, or Glock handguns which are used as airsoft green gas or CO2 airsoft pistol versions.
Airsoft players typically wear camouflage patterns during games along with headgear like tactical vests and tactical helmets configured with pouches. Each opposing airsoft team often wears a specific pattern to help identify friendly and unfriendly forces.
The targets airsoft weapons are shot at can differ depending on game type. The majority of the targets engaged with airsoft guns are other participants throughout force-on-force fights.
There are lots of types of airsoft games. The types of airsoft missions are rather limitless as players create more kinds all of the time.
What is military simulation airsoft?
Military simulation airsoft, or milsim, is usually a significant component of airsoft. Milsim is the art of imitating a military setting. Often this includes a command element, trucks, and semi-realistic environments with mock battlefield pyrotechnics or special effects. Much of the airsoft guns, uniforms, and objectives are reproductions of realistic weapons, fatigues, and real-world objectives out of the history books. The end result of a well done military simulation airsoft event causes game players looking very military-esque and kitted like spec ops.
Milsim airsoft guns are based on the era featuring popular weapons during the time of the historical objective. The M16A1 rifle has the timeless look of a Vietnam age assault rifle, while other airsoft rifles like the Heckler & Koch HK416 and IWI TAVOR TAR-21 are much more modern-day. In rigorous milsim gameplay, weapons must follow the age, use associated scopes, and be suitably modded.
Milsim uniforms can vary based on the forces and be based around the historical gear loadouts of the time. The tactical equipment used normally needs to be and match the uniform from the corresponding era. A contemporary U.S. Navy Seal milsim uniform and loadout might incorporate a Navy Working Uniform (NWU) camouflage pattern with a London Bridge Trading LBT-6094 Plate Carrier Gen II vest and a ballistic helmet like the Ops-Core FAST SF Super High Cut Helmet. Replica tactical equipment and ballistic panels and helmets are generally used in place of the legitimate gear. This helps to save cash considering that the real gear can cost 1000s of dollars and the imitation gear is lighter to move around with on the airsoft field.
The missions undertaken during milsim operations include historic reenactments and objectives set as historical fiction.
